在ROS中,当我们有多个传感器发布的数据需要同步时,message_filters::Synchronizer
是一个非常有用的工具。它可以确保多个消息在时间上是同步的,以便更有效地处理数据。
1.什么是ROS消息过滤器?
ROS消息过滤器是一种用于处理ROS消息的工具,允许我们对消息进行过滤、同步和组合。这对于在机器人感知中整合不同传感器数据或在控制中同步多个输入源非常重要。
2.message_filters::Synchronizer
简介
message_filters::Synchronizer
是ROS中消息过滤器的一部分,专门用于同步多个消息。它可以确保多个发布者发布的消息在时间上是同步的,以便在回调函数中处理这些消息。
3.使用场景
当你有多个传感器发布的数据,需要确保这些数据在同一时刻可用时,message_filters::Synchronizer
就派上用场了。例如,在处理相机图像和激光雷达扫描数据时,你可能希望它们在相同的时间戳上可用,以便更准确地进行感知。

4.2 订阅者节点 (synchronized_subscriber.cpp
)
#include <ros/ros.h>
#include <sensor_msgs/Image.h>
#include <sensor_msgs/PointCloud2.h>
#include <message_filters/subscriber.h>
#include <message_filters/synchronizer.h>
#include <message_filters/sync_policies/approximate_time.h>
void callback(const sensor_msgs::Image::ConstPtr& image_msg, const sensor_msgs::PointCloud2::ConstPtr& pcl_msg)
{
// 处理同步的消息
// image_msg 和 pcl_msg 在相同时间戳下
ROS_INFO("Received synchronized the message of image_msg at time %f", image_msg->header.stamp.toSec());
ROS_INFO("Received synchronized the message of pcl_msg message at time %f", pcl_msg->header.stamp.toSec());
ROS_INFO("------------------------------------------------------------------------");
}
int main(int argc, char** argv)
{
ros::init(argc, argv, "synchronized_subscriber");
ros::NodeHandle nh;
// 创建两个订阅者
message_filters::Subscriber<sensor_msgs::Image> image_sub(nh, "/image_topic", 1);
message_filters::Subscriber<sensor_msgs::PointCloud2> pcl_sub(nh, "/pointcloud_topic", 1);
// 定义同步策略为 ApproximateTime
typedef message_filters::sync_policies::ApproximateTime<sensor_msgs::Image, sensor_msgs::PointCloud2> MySyncPolicy;
// 创建同步器对象
message_filters::Synchronizer<MySyncPolicy> sync(MySyncPolicy(10), image_sub, pcl_sub);
// 注册回调函数
sync.registerCallback(boost::bind(&callback, _1, _2));
ros::spin();
return 0;
}

4.5 代码解释
- 引入必要的ROS和消息过滤器头文件。
- 定义回调函数
callback
,用于处理同步的图像和激光雷达数据。 - 在
main
函数中创建message_filters::Subscriber
对象,分别订阅相机图像和激光雷达扫描数据。 - 使用
message_filters::sync_policies::ApproximateTime
创建message_filters::Synchronizer
对象,设置时间同步策略为近似同步。 - 注册回调函数到
Synchronizer
对象中,它将在图像和激光雷达数据近似同步时调用。
